Humanoids From The Deep ‎– The Lost Contact / The Last Contact - Overdrive (0285)

The Lost Contact

The Last Contact

Code: OVER 049-12 - Bought: 3.11.94 - Released: 1994 - Barcode: ??

LINK to Discogs